Output 8d6252902583f4d9f322576eaaff615628174d56c19b4ff034bbb32ea45ac17c:0

value
12962466
script pubkey
OP_0 OP_PUSHBYTES_20 84e4c0484e762dd94fe101d4a51a5ece620a603e
address
ltc1qsnjvqjzwwckajnlpq8222xj7ee3q5cp7ngr28r
transaction
8d6252902583f4d9f322576eaaff615628174d56c19b4ff034bbb32ea45ac17c
spent
true